Long story short Luxie has mild HD vet says we caught it early But the vet and radiologist have looked at her front elbow x rays and are concerned she might have a trochlear notch lesion and maybe some small fractures in her elbows.... when lux goes to lay down probably (30-50) times a day she basically plops down and falls on her elbows first and her bones hit the wooden floors. Vet says this could have caused the lesion and the fast wear and tear on her elbows. Does anyone know how I get her to lay down easily? I mean she voluntarily lays down hard basically plopping down whenever she wants to rest. I have no idea how to fix this and I thought to look here first before I try to find a trainer to stop this habit. Hope yall can help! Thanks Ryan
